Non-listed aquatic animal species introduced from third countries. Definitions of what constitutes an aquatic animal and a listed species are laid down in the EU Animal Health Regulation.

Regulations amending the Swedish Board of Agriculture’s regulations and general recommendations (SJVFS 2021:13) on registration, approval, traceability, movement, import and export with regard to animal health

Non-listed aquatic animal species may only be introduced from third countries which are members of the World Organisation for Animal Health (OIE) or which are listed in Commission Implementing Regulation (EU) 2021/404 of 24 March 2021 laying down lists of third countries, territories or zones thereof from which the entry into the Union of animals, germinal products and products of animal origin is permitted in accordance with Regulation (EU) 2016/429 of the European Parliament and of the Council.

Consignments shall be accompanied by the same type of animal health certificate as applies to listed aquatic animal species.
The provisions include requirements for the conditions during transport.
All provisions are Swedish special provisions because the EU has chosen not to regulate non-listed species.
The provisions concern introduction from third countries and are deemed to be subject to the WTO notification requirements under the SPS Agreement.
